المملكة: What did the toxicology reports reveal in the trial of the Saudi student’s killer in Britain?

The trial sessions for the accused murderer continue at the British Crown Court in Cambridge" Saudi student Muhammad Al-Qasim, amid anticipation that the jury will issue its decisive decision next week, after revealing that the perpetrator used drugs.
The official toxicology reports presented before the court revealed that He was under the influence of cocaine and alcohol at the time of committing the crime last summer.
In an attempt to justify his position, the defendant claimed before the jury that he did not intend to, claiming that his goal was limited to intimidation by using a knife in a case of self-defense.
Refuting the accused’s story
Public prosecutors responded strongly during the second week of the trial, presenting conclusive evidence that included medical reports, surveillance camera recordings, and witness testimonies to refute the accused’s story.
The court finished hearing all parties, as the case is now in the hands of the jury composed to evaluate the evidence and the bare facts.
The jury is expected to issue a ruling. Its final decision will be made soon, amid legal expectations that a life sentence will be issued if the accused is convicted of premeditated murder.
